Acer Aspire One 531 Netbook Review

Acer Aspire One 531


Acer have been producing laptops for a number of years now and were also one of the first manufacturers to start making netbooks. The Acer Aspire One 531 netbook is the follow on model from the Aspire One which was a very popular model.

The 531 features a larger 10″ screen an integrated Wi-Fi. The unit features a solid build and a very thin case making it strong but also very portable. The keyboard is very usable as is the trackpad which is on the larger side for a netbook. The trackpad also has some nice features to make browsing the web and viewing images much easier.

The battery life is staggering producing over nine hours of power. It also has a number of memory card slots and will take SD, xD and Sony sticks.

The general spec is a fairly standard one for a netbook; 160GB hard disk, 1GB RAM etc. Although the processor does produce pretty good results.

The Acer Aspire One 531 is a nice progression from its predecessor offering higher than average speed and very good battery life. This fits into the “must have” netbook category!
